What Is New York Highway Use Tax (HUT)?

The New York Highway Use Tax (HUT) is a state tax imposed on heavy commercial vehicles that operate on public highways in New York. It is designed to ensure that trucks causing greater wear and tear on state roads contribute fairly to highway maintenance and infrastructure funding.


Which Commercial Trucks Are Subject to NY HUT?

NY HUT applies to commercial vehicles that:

  • Have a gross weight over 18,000 pounds, or

  • Have an unladen weight over 8,000 pounds, or

  • Are registered with a maximum gross weight over 18,000 pounds

Both New York–based and out-of-state carriers must comply if they operate qualifying vehicles in New York.


HUT Permit Requirements

Before operating in New York, qualifying carriers must:

  • Obtain a NY HUT Certificate of Registration

  • Carry a HUT decal or proof of registration in the vehicle

  • File required HUT tax returns, even if no tax is due

Failure to have a valid HUT permit can result in roadside fines and vehicle delays.


How NY HUT Is Calculated

NY HUT is calculated based on:

  • Vehicle weight

  • Miles traveled in New York State

  • Applicable HUT rate schedule

Only miles driven within New York are taxable. Rates increase as vehicle weight increases.

Penalties for Non-Compliance

Non-compliance can lead to:

  • Fines and interest charges

  • Suspension of HUT registration

  • Out-of-service orders

  • Increased enforcement scrutiny
